Herein, we reported an electrocatalytic oxidation strategy to transform polyethylene terephthalate (PET) plastic-derived ethylene glycol (EG) and biomass-derived polyols into formamide, into the existence of ammonia (NH3) over a tungsten oxide (WO3) catalyst. Taking EG-to-formamide for example, we accomplished a high formamide productivity of 537.7 μmol cm-2 h-1 with FE of 43.2 percent at a constant present of 100 mA cm-2 in a flow electrolyzer with 12-h test, representing a more advantageous performance compared with earlier reports for formamide electrosynthesis. Mechanistic understanding disclosed that the cleavage regarding the C-C bond into the EG was facilitated by nucleophilic attack of in situ formed nitrogen radicals from NH3, with resultant C-N bond construction and finally formamide production. Moreover, this strategy could be extended to transformation of PET container and a few biomass-derived polyols with carbon number from three (glycerol) to six (glucose), producing formamide with high efficiencies. This work shows a sustainable upgrading strategy of plastic and biomass which will have ramifications to more value-added chemicals manufacturing beyond carbs. The responsibility of HIV and other sexually transmitted attacks (STIs) continues to be high in intercourse workers globally, calling for strengthening focused prevention strategies, including HIV pre-exposure prophylaxis (PrEP). The analysis’s goal would be to examine LY2228820 datasheet HIV and STI burden among feminine, male and transgender intercourse employees in Flanders, Belgium, to guide targeting of PrEP strategies for intercourse workers. The analysis included a total of 6028 sex employees, comprising 5617 (93.2%) feminine, 218 (3.6%) male and 193 (3.2%) transgender sex employees. The HIV prevalence had been 0.3% among feminine, 8.9% among male and 12.3% among transgender intercourse workers. Participating in escort sex work and originating from south usa or Sub-Saharan Africa were connected with an increased possibility of having obtained HIV. The positivity price for gonorrhoea was greater among male intercourse workers (5.2% vs 2.2%) and syphilis had been more often detected among male and transgender sex workers (3.0% and 6.1% vs 0.5%), all compared with feminine sex workers.
